Transaction 625d10d83e0813dd24e107bee981da0c1124fc6c3af42b4e2206ef664ca58b69

1 Input
2 Outputs
  • 625d10d83e0813dd24e107bee981da0c1124fc6c3af42b4e2206ef664ca58b69:0
  • value  17255736829
    address  35shcUDEsAURX4qo3jnKuvt7SjaUt9Bgmz
  • 625d10d83e0813dd24e107bee981da0c1124fc6c3af42b4e2206ef664ca58b69:1
  • value  354767
    address  3E6op9pzLvXJ1omrNBQbyjgC5idjoc6gGu